Admission to the MSc in Biology program at KNU requires a minimum of 50% merit score from the applicant's undergraduate program. The selection process is organized through counselling rounds. The program is supported by experienced faculty known for effectively managing and educating students, especially in challenging subjects like pharmacology. The total fee for this two-year master's course is around 15,000 Rs, divided into semester payments. This fee is considered affordable and offers good value for the education provided.
Placement opportunities have improved, with faculty support helping students secure internships and jobs. Graduates often pursue roles such as marketing officers in pharmaceutical companies and sales executives. Scholarships are available for students with an annual income under 1 lakh and for those in reserved or government-declared categories, assisting financially challenged students in accessing higher education.
